The way points of this bicycle route:
If you are on folding bike, take MRT to City Hall or Orchard Road station, change to suttle bus (free) and get off at Great World City. First half of this scenic route is about the culture of Singapore. and the second half ride is mainly across shaded parks.
cycling down a small slope from the suttle bus stop, change to pavement. If there is not much car, you may want to cross the dangerous Kim Seng Road at the top of the slope which give you a clear view over a longer distance. WARNING, car are very fast here and you have to cross all the lane in one go!
I prefer cycling along the pavement down the slope, wait for the traffic light at the pedestrain crossing here. Stress free.
Entrance just next to Mirrage Tower. Nice thing about this ride is that there are bike paths along both sides of the river (mostly), and there are many foot/cycle bridges provided. Your path may be slight different.
